President Emmerson Mnangagwa has urged ZANU PF Women’s League to create internal capacities to increase production and productivity in Zimbabwe.

President Mnangagwa said this while speaking at the 7th ZANU PF Women’s League Conference at Harare International Conference Centre (H.I.C.C), where he bemoaned the effect of sanctions on  the country's economy as he made an urgent call for the country to  strengthen its economic resilience.

“In the face of the continued illegal and unwarranted economic sanctions against our country and other global shocks, it is imperative that we build and strengthen our country’s economic resilience. I, therefore urge the woman’s league to create capacities for increased production and productivity of our ‘Made in Zimbabwe’ goods and services.

“Scale up your resolve as Women’s League and women in general, to be bold creators and builders of communities and the Zimbabwe we all want,” said President Mnangagwa.
